Former world heavyweight champion Tyson Fury has introduced his return to boxing, having retired from the game in December 2024 after dropping to Oleksandr Usyk in a bout for 3 of the 4 main world titles.
The British star confirmed his comeback in a submit on social media, which units up the prospect of a long-awaited showdown with Anthony Joshua.
Fury posted on Instagram that “2026 is that 12 months. Return of the mac.”
“Been away for some time however I’m again now, 37 years previous and nonetheless punching,” he stated. “Nothing higher to do than punch males within the face and receives a commission for it.”
Earlier than his two bouts with Usyk, Fury was unbeaten in 35 fights, profitable 34 and drawing one.
Fury didn’t point out potential opponents, however his announcement comes after elevated hypothesis a couple of conflict with British rival Joshua in 2026. Joshua, who can be a former world champion, final month knocked out YouTube star Jake Paul. However he was injured in a deadly automotive crash that killed two of his buddies in Nigeria this week, which has resulted in uncertainty over his quick plans.
Fury is a two-time world champion. He ended the reign of Wladimir Klitschko with a factors win in 2015 that noticed him topped Tremendous WBA, IBF and WBO champion.
He didn’t battle once more till 2018 – however an exhilarating trilogy with American Deontay Wilder resulted in a draw and two victories for him to assert the WBC title.
Fury beforehand stated he was retiring after he beat Dillian Whyte in 2022, however was again within the ring the next 12 months.
A battle with Joshua has lengthy been anticipated. There may be additionally the potential of a trilogy-capping battle with Usyk or a conflict with WBO champion Fabio Wardley.
